Connect with us and
transform your ideas into reality
Studio address
3626 Liberty Avenue Los Angeles,
California (CA), 90071
Contact
Studio hours
Monday to Friday: 9:00 AM – 5:00 PM
Saturday & Sunday: Closed
Communication and press
We're at
California
Morocco

